    The largest Christian community is the Sacred Heart Catholic  
    Church with its principal worship centre in Manama. The
    Sacred Heart School was founded there but has grown out of
    those premises. You can find more information on the Catholic

    St. Christopher’s Cathedral, in the diocese of ‘Cyprus and the
    Gulf’, is the Anglican church in Manama and is over 50 years
    old.  [ www.stchcathedral.org.bh ]. St. Christopher’s School,
    the largest British curriculum school in Bahrain was founded in
    the cathedral compound. More than 30 years ago the school
    moved to larger premises and is now located  in three different
    locations away from Manama.  

    The National Evangelical Church (NEC) in Manama dates back
    to the end of the nineteenth century when  Christian medical
    missionaries of the Reformed Church of America came here.
    Their legacy remains in both the NEC and the American
    Mission Hospital located in the same compound.

    Many years ago a multi-denominational Christian church
    building was erected in Awali by BAPCO, the Bahrain oil
    company. A number of denominations utilise this building
    which although small has a very devotional atmosphere with a
    beautiful stained glass window.
